Abstract
In this paper, the effects of the location of APs on positioning error are discussed in received signal strength (RSS) value based scheme. The RSS values are measured to know the RSS characteristics of AP as the distance between the AP and the receiver is increased. The positioning errors are evaluated with three APs. A triangle is formed with three APs and the errors are distinguished by inside error and outside error, respectively, whether the receiver is located inside the triangle or not. The results indicate the inside errors of triangle, which is formed by three APs, are lower than outside errors.
